Docker安装PostgreSQL

Docker安装PostgreSQL

一、安装:

docker pull postgres

二、接下来就是运行postgresSQL镜像的步骤了

  1. 先创建你要指定的数据目录 mkdir -p /home/ZhangYiwen/pgdata

  2. 运行命令

    docker run --name postgres14.0 -e POSTGRES_PASSWORD=postgres -p 25432:5432 -v /home/ZhangYiwen/pgdata:/var/lib/postgresql/data -d postgres:latest
    ​
    --name postgres14.0 指定容器的名称
    ​
    -e POSTGRES_PASSWORD=postgres  设置环境变量,指定数据库的用户名和密码,用户名为postgres,密码为:postgres
    ​
    -p 25432:5432  指定端口:前面为映射的端口号,后面为镜像的端口号
    ​
    -v /home/ZhangYiwen/pgdata:/var/lib/postgresql/data 指定宿主机的目录和原数据目录
    ​
    -d postgres:latest  指定镜像名称以及版本号
    ​
    PS:postgres镜像默认的用户名为postgres
    ​
posted @ 2021-11-05 15:23  yiwenzhang  阅读(2545)  评论(0编辑  收藏  举报